Digital Design Engineer
Credo is a leader in high-speed connectivity solutions, focusing on innovative technologies that transform connectivity at scale. The Digital Design Engineer will be responsible for designing complex digital logic for next-generation communication ICs, collaborating closely with various teams to ensure high-quality product delivery.

Responsibilities
Utilize electrical engineering and digital design skills to design complex high-speed integrated circuits, which include the following duties
Write microarchitecture and/or design specifications of sub-blocks designed for Credo’s high-speed communication Integrated Circuits (IC’s) including a description of the intended functions of the sub-block and inputs and outputs of the sub-block
Design, implement, and debug complex logic designs for Credo’s high speed communication IC’s
Develop testbenches and tests to verify complex verilog RTL Designs
Develop test benches and tests to verify Gate-Level Netlists
Integrate complex IPs used as building blocks for Credo’s high-speed communication IC’s
Support all front-end integration activities like Lint, CDC, Synthesis, and ECO Work with other ASIC (Application Specific Integrated Circuit) Design/Verification, DFT and Physical Design Engineers in the team
Collaborate with Credo’s Software/Firmware and systems teams to ensure a high-quality end product; and, Bring-up the Chips, debug and Validation in the Laboratory
Utilize the following tools and technologies to perform the above duties
Hardware Descriptive Languages such as Verilog or VHDL; Cadence Xcelium or Synopsys VCS Verification/Simulation tools or equivalent; Linux based systems; and automation and scripting languages like Python
Qualification
Required
Master's deg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or a closely related field of study
Demonstrated knowledge of Verilog/SystemVerilog and scripting languages such as Python
Demonstrated knowledge of Static Timing Analysis, VLSI Design, and Digital Design
Demonstrated knowledge of EDA tools such as Cadence Xcelium or NCSim, and Linux operating environments
